Louis XVIII, King of France, 19th century. Louis (1755-1824) became king in 1814 when the monarchy was restored after the defeat of Napoleon. He fled Paris when Napoleon returned from Elba to re-establish his rule during the Hundred Days in 1815 but regained the throne after Bonapartes final defeat at Waterloo

Louis XVIII ascended to the throne in 1814 when the monarchy was restored after Napoleon's defeat. However, his reign faced tumultuous times as he fled Paris during Napoleon's return from Elba in 1815. It was only after Bonaparte's ultimate defeat at Waterloo that Louis XVIII regained his rightful place on the throne. In this portrait, we witness a man who has experienced both exile and triumphs.
